Diary reveals all manner of ship debauchery

VIOLENCE, drunkenness and all manner of debauchery featured on a six-month voyage on a migrant ship bound for Australia 170 years ago, a newly discovered diary reveals.

Diary reveals all manner of ship debauchery

The raunchy tale is recorded by a junior officer, James Bell, aboard The Planter, which sailed to Adelaide from Deptford in east London in 1838.

Acts of ā€œgreat violenceā€ involving officers, mates and even the ship’s doctor are all recounted.
